Answer:

The correct answer is option 2- "by eating sunflower seeds".

Explanation:

Cardinals are a species of bird that live in North and South America, characterized by its color being majority red with a minor proportion of black. Cardinals eat sunflowers seeds, serving as a predator for this plant and helping the ecosystem by reducing the size of sunflowers populations. What is the starch indicator, and how does it change?
kow [346]

Answer:

<h3><em>Starch is a indicator in the iodometric titration and it turns deep dark blue when iodine is present in a solution. The starch under warming condition forms amylose and amylo pectins which combine with iodine to produce dark blue color.In absence of iodide ion starch indicator is colorless.</em></h3>

Communication between sdn controllers and routers is governed by ________.
galben [10]

Answer;

-Northbound APIs

Communication between SDN controllers and routers is governed by Northbound APIs.

Explanation;

-The northbound application programming interface (API) on an SDN controller enables applications and orchestration systems to program the network and request services from it.

-Northbound APIs can enable network functions like path computation, loop avoidance, routing and security. The northbound APIs can also used to facilitate innovation and enable efficient orchestration and automation of the network to align with the needs of different applications via SDN network programmability.
